Pi Network continues strengthening its technical infrastructure as Node operators are encouraged to complete a required upgrade process from earlier versions to the latest available release. The update has attracted attention among Pioneers because Nodes play an important role in supporting blockchain performance, security, and future ecosystem development.
According to a community update shared by @pibrens, all Pi Node operators must upgrade sequentially from version v19 to v26.1, meaning users should not skip intermediate versions during the upgrade process.
This requirement highlights the importance of maintaining a consistent software environment across the network.

Understanding the Sequential Upgrade Requirement
The instruction for operators to upgrade from v19 to v26.1 without skipping versions is an important technical requirement.
Sequential upgrades allow software changes to be applied properly.
Each version may contain improvements, adjustments, security updates, or compatibility changes that prepare the system for the next release.
Skipping versions could create potential issues because certain updates may depend on previous changes being installed first.
This approach is common in software development, especially for systems that require high reliability.
Blockchain infrastructure must maintain consistency because even small compatibility problems can affect network performance.
